Main Responsibilities
The Data Specialist will be responsible for data gathering, visualisation and interpretation of data.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Work with stakeholders to understand their data and reporting needs, using the different platforms and other tools to develop and maintain the capabilities to aid them in their daytoday decision making.
  • To build strong relationships to ensure datadriven decisions are taken at all levels.
  • To develop processes that are scalable, automating wherever possible, and providing clear and repeatable documentation.
  • To develop, improve and maintain data products, selfservice tools, reporting and statistical analysis that unearth business insights.
  • Understand data governance and help deliver a compliant data service.
  • To build reports to support the delivery of insight back to the internal business.
  • Understanding and interpreting data to drive actionable insights to achieve commercial and strategic business objectives
  • Work closely with the senior leadership team to identify and help to solve key business problems.
  • Supporting functions such as finance to report on the success of projects and build more accurate forecasting models
  • Over time, work with the wider data team to integrate the other sources of data and analytics we collect to build a more rounded understanding
  • Facilitate data modelling, data cleansing, and data enrichment, and understand where to use different types of data models, industryrecognised datamodelling patterns and standards
The successful Data Specialist will have a structured and analytical profile, simplifying complex projects and delivering business objectives in a systematic fashion

  • Motivated by impact and ensuring your work generates real commercial outcomes
  • Able to connect the dots between business goals, technology/data capability and stakeholder needs
  • At least 2 years previous experience working in a role with a strong BI, insights or analytics component
  • A team player who takes energy from working with others to solve big, key problems; communicating effectively with stakeholders at all levels of the organization
  • Effective at prioritisation and able to work independently; have an eye for the highimpact initiatives over others
  • Strong stakeholder management skills
  • Strong ability to work with SQL and in Excel and a quick learner on selfserve analytical tools (e.g. Looker)
  • Prior experience in using Looker and Google Big Query would be an advantage, but not a deal breaker.
  • Highly organised with strong attention to detail.
  • Able to use multiple systems and multitask in a fastpaced environment
